Verstappen overtakes Alonso in F1 and goes for win record

0

Achieving a victory in the highest category of motorsports is something only reserved for a privileged few who manage to demonstrate the talent they possess and cross the finish line in first position. It is something that 112 drivers have done throughout history, the last of them to join the list, Carlos Sainz at the 2022 British Grand Prix, but although reaching this historic classification is already difficult, climbing positions in her it is much more complicated.

Lewis Hamilton remains on top with 103 wins , followed by Michael Schumacher with 91 and Sebastian Vettel with 53 , while Alain Prost has 51 and Ayrton Senna with 41 . Fernando Alonso was placed behind, with 32 victories throughout his journey through Formula 1, but in the last United States Grand Prix, Max Verstappen managed to overtake the Spaniard to become the sixth driver who has stepped on top the most times from the podium.

The Dutchman broke all kinds of records since he landed at the Grand Circus, becoming the youngest to compete in a race, being still a minor, at 17 years, 5 months and 15 days , as well as being the youngest to win an appointment at the championship, at the 2016 Spanish Grand Prix in his debut with Red Bull. At that time, nobody in the paddock thought that he could achieve the numbers he is having, and that is that in his career, he accumulates a percentage of more than 20%, which means that out of every five appointments, he wins one.

If you take into account that in his first steps in Formula 1, it was not until 2021 when he began to dominate with a much more competitive Red Bull, and that is that of 41 grand prix, he has won 23, that is, more than 56 % , one out of every two races. This is how you achieve memorable eras in sport, as others like Michael Jordan, Leo Messi, Roger Federer or Valentino Rossi did, even in the same category, with Michael Schumacher.

If he continues with a similar percentage, it will not take long to catch up with Lewis Hamilton and his 103 victories, and around 2028 or 2029 , just when his current contract with the Milton Keynes team ends, he would already surpass him, with just 31 years of experience. age, when the British and the ‘ Kaiser ‘ were still for their third world title.

The drivers with the most victories in the history of Formula 1 after the 2022 US GP

Position Pilot victories
 Lewis Hamilton 103
 Michael Schumacher 91
 Sebastian Vettel 53
 Alain Prost 51
 Ayrton Senna 41
 Max Verstappen 33
7th Fernando Alonso 32
 Nigel Mansell 31
 Jackie Stewart 27
10º  Jim Clark 25
